Authorities are investigating a shooting that killed one man and injured another on Lakeshore Drive in Camden on Saturday morning. Yahmir Catoe, 18, of Camden was found by police suffering from a gunshot wound while lying on the ground in a nearby park. Police responded to the area after receiving multiple 911 calls regarding a shooting, according to according to Camden County Prosecutor Grace C. MacAulay andCatoe was transported to Cooper University Hospital, where was pronounced decease at 4:22 p.m., according to authorities.
